MyYahoo will roll out a series of updates on Thursday, the main one being inline editing. This new way of editing the page means you can make all your changes - adding/removing modules, changing colors and adjusting your setting - without leaving the page.

It's using javascrpt, of course, and you can see the editing process in the screenshots below. As far as I'm aware, Netvibes and Pageflakes already had similar capabilities.

Other changes include some fixes to the Yahoo Calendar module (keep track of events for multiple days and months, and no need to navigate away when switching between days) and the addition of a MyNetflix module to view the movies in your personal queue, among other things (see bottom screenshot). There's also a new Yahoo Bookmarks module.
